JYSK reaches 2,500 stores

JYSK celebrates that 2017 became the year when JYSK opened store number 2,500, thereby reaching yet another milestone in the company’s history.

Expansion has been the main driver for the sleeping and living expert JYSK, since owner and founder Lars Larsen opened the first JYSK store in Denmark in 1979.

In August 2017, JYSK opened store number 2,500 spread over the 48 countries where JYSK operates today. And the journey is far from over.

“It has always been the goal to have JYSK stores all over the world, so there is still a lot of work to do. But a reaching 2,500 stores is of course something to celebrate, and the way to do that is of course by having a lot of great offers for our customers and a competition with great prizes,” says Lars Larsen.

Celebrations across the world

Store number 2,500 is thus celebrated with an international campaign focusing on the continued expansion of JYSK as well as product quality and JYSK values.

“Having 2,500 JYSK stores is not only great for me. It also benefits the customers, because JYSK has a presence as the local expert in sleeping and living in a lot of cities. This makes it possible for JYSK to achieve our vision of being a great Scandinavian offer for everyone,” explains Lars Larsen.

Great employees

He underlines that the success of JYSK has only been possible as the result of the great efforts by JYSK’s employees throughout the years.

“Constant development and expansion requires skilled and dedicated employees. I would therefore like to thank all of the employees who have contributed to make JYSK the success that it is today,” says Lars Larsen.

JYSK is an international chain of stores with Scandinavian roots that sells everything for the home. The first store opened in Denmark in 1979, and today JYSK has over 2,500 stores and 21,000 employees in 48 countries. In Germany and Austria the stores are called Dänisches Bettenlager – in the rest of the world JYSK. JYSK is owned by the Danish tradesman Lars Larsen, who owns a number of companies with a total annual turnover of 27 billion DKK. JYSK’s turnover is 23.2 billion DKK.

JYSK is an international home furnishing retailer with Scandinavian roots that makes it easy to furnish every room in any home and garden.

With more than 3,400 stores and webshops in 48 countries, JYSK always has a great offer and competent service nearby, no matter how customers want to shop.

Founder Lars Larsen opened his first store in Denmark in 1979. Today, JYSK employs 31,000 colleagues.

JYSK is part of family-owned Lars Larsen Group with a total turnover of DKK 44.0 billion in financial year 2022/23. JYSK’s turnover was DKK 41.1 billion in financial year 2023/24.
